随着互联网的飞速发展,网页设计已经成为了一个备受关注的热门领域。而在网页设计中,代码是构建网站骨架的关键元素。本文将从网页设计常用的代码入手,探讨如何在代码运用中打造极致用户体验的艺术。
一、HTML:网页设计的基石
HTML(HyperText Markup Language)是网页设计的基石,它定义了网页的结构和内容。在HTML5推出之前,网页设计主要依赖于HTML、CSS和JavaScript。HTML5的出现,使得网页设计更加便捷、高效。
1. 结构化标签:在HTML5中,结构化标签得到了充分的运用,如
2. 响应式设计:HTML5支持响应式设计,通过媒体查询(Media Queries)等技术,实现网页在不同设备上的适配,满足用户在不同场景下的浏览需求。
二、CSS:网页设计的灵魂
CSS(Cascading Style Sheets)负责网页的样式和布局,是网页设计的灵魂。通过CSS,我们可以实现网页的美观、大方、简洁。
1. 选择器:CSS选择器是编写样式的基础,如类选择器、ID选择器、标签选择器等。选择器的运用,有助于提高代码的可读性和可维护性。
2. 布局技术:CSS布局技术包括浮动、定位、弹性盒子等。掌握这些布局技术,可以帮助我们实现网页的多样化布局,提升用户体验。
三、JavaScript:网页设计的生命力
JavaScript是网页设计的生命力,它负责网页的动态效果和交互功能。在网页设计中,JavaScript发挥着至关重要的作用。
1. 事件处理:JavaScript可以监听并处理网页上的各种事件,如鼠标点击、键盘按键等。通过事件处理,实现网页的动态效果和交互功能。
2. 动画与特效:JavaScript提供了丰富的动画与特效库,如jQuery、GSAP等。利用这些库,可以制作出富有创意的网页效果,提升用户体验。
四、Vue.js与React:现代网页设计的利器
随着前端技术的发展,Vue.js和React等框架应运而生。这些框架极大地提高了前端开发的效率,降低了开发成本。
1. Vue.js:Vue.js是一款渐进式JavaScript框架,易于上手。它具有简洁的语法、组件化开发、双向数据绑定等特点,深受开发者喜爱。
2. React:React是由Facebook推出的JavaScript库,主要用于构建用户界面。React具有虚拟DOM、组件化开发、状态管理等特点,是现代前端开发的主流框架。
在网页设计中,代码是构建网站骨架的关键元素。掌握HTML、CSS、JavaScript等常用代码,并结合Vue.js、React等现代前端框架,有助于我们打造极致用户体验的艺术。这只是一个起点,网页设计还需关注交互设计、用户体验、SEO等多个方面,才能在激烈的市场竞争中脱颖而出。
引用权威资料:
1. 《HTML5与CSS3权威指南》——ISBN:978-7-115-34646-8
2. 《JavaScript高级程序设计》——ISBN:978-7-115-33539-2
3. 《React入门与实践》——ISBN:978-7-115-34924-4